Before Meeting
Your AI agent analyzes client performance data, support tickets, and market trends to identify key insights and potential areas for discussion. You receive a draft QBR presentation with talking points and data visualizations.
During Meeting
As you discuss client performance, your AI agent provides real-time data updates and answers to ad-hoc questions. It also captures action items and assigns follow-up tasks.
After Meeting
Post-meeting, your AI agent generates a summary of key discussion points, action items, and next steps. It also updates your CRM with relevant client information.

Things to Keep in Mind When Building a Meeting Planner Agent
Building an effective meeting planner agent requires careful planning and attention to detail. The goal is to create an agent that seamlessly integrates with your existing workflows and provides a user-friendly experience for all participants.
Define Clear Objectives
Before you start building your agent, define clear objectives for what you want it to achieve. Do you want to reduce QBR preparation time, improve the quality of your presentations, enhance client engagement, or all of the above? Having clear objectives will help you prioritize features and measure success.
Integrate with Existing CRM and Data Analytics Tools
Ensure that your agent integrates seamlessly with your existing CRM and data analytics tools. This will allow it to access the data it needs to generate insights and create presentations.
Prioritize User Experience
Make sure that the agent is easy to use and intuitive. The interface should be clean and uncluttered, and the QBR preparation process should be straightforward and efficient.
Automate Data Analysis and Presentation Creation
Configure the agent to automatically analyze client data and generate presentation-ready materials. This will save you hours of preparation time and ensure that your QBRs are always up-to-date.
Provide Customizable Templates and Settings
Allow users to customize the agent's templates and settings to match their preferences. This might include choosing which data points to include in the presentation, setting preferred presentation styles, and specifying notification preferences.
Test Thoroughly
Before you roll out the agent to your entire team, test it thoroughly to ensure that it is working correctly and that it meets your objectives. Gather feedback from users and make any necessary adjustments.
Continuously Improve
Once your agent is live, continue to monitor its performance and gather feedback from users. Use this information to identify areas for improvement and make ongoing enhancements.
